The current health expenditure as a share of the GDP in South Africa was forecast to continuously increase between 2024 and 2029 by in total 0.1 percentage points. After the twelfth consecutive increasing year, the share is estimated to reach 8.77 percent and therefore a new peak in 2029. According to Worldbank health spending includes expenditures with regards to healthcare services and goods.
